如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
开题报告题目名称INS/GPS组合导航软件平台设计与开发题目来源B题目类型2导师姓名王磊学生姓名李建亮班级学号0901012215专业机械设计制造及其自动化一.课题背景和意义惯性导航系统(INS)通过加速度计实时测量载体运动的加速度,经积分运算得到载体的实时速度和位置信息,是一种完全自主的导航系统,具有不依赖外界信息、隐蔽性好、抗辐射性强、全天候等优点,是机载设备中能提供多种导航参数的重要导航设备。惯性导航系统一般由惯性传感器模块、导航解算模块、电路系统、电源模块、滤波模块和外壳等部分组成。但它的定位误差随时间而积累,长时间工作后会产生大的误差,使得惯性导航系统不宜作远距离导航。全球定位系统(GPS)继惯性导航以后导航技术的又一大进展,其由空间卫星、地面监控设施以及用户接收机三部分组成。具有较高的导航精度,但是该系统不能提供如载体姿态等导航参数,且在载体上使用时,由于载体的机动运动,常使接收机不易捕获和跟踪卫星的载波信号,甚至对已跟踪的信号失锁。因此为了克服惯性导航与全球定位系统的缺点,多根据INS和GPS的导航功能互补的特点,以适当的方法将两者组合来提高系统的整体导航精度及导航性能以及空中对准和再对准的能力GPS接收机在惯导位置和速度信息的辅助下,也将改善捕获、跟踪和再捕获的能力,并在卫星分布条件差或可见星少的情况下导航精度不致下降过大。由于优点显著,GPS/INS组合系统被一致认为是载体最理想的组合导航系统。国内外研究现状鉴于各种单一的各种导航系统有这样那样的缺点,上世纪70年代,现代组合导航系统在航海、航空与航天等领域随着现代高科技的发展应运而生。随着电子计算机技术特别是微机技术的迅猛发展和现代控制系统理论的进步,组合导航技术开始迅猛发展起来。过去单独使用的各种导航设备,通过微型电子计算机有机的组合到一起,发展各自的特点、扬长避短,组合导航成为目前导航技术发展的重要方向之一。从上个世纪80年代开始,英、美、法等国的军方和民用部门开始了对GPS/INS组合导航平台的研究。80年代后期欧美各国在MSVisualStudioC++6.0仿真软件平台上,实现了INS/GPS组合导航的解算,同时在Windows2000操作界面上实现了曲线和数据的同步显示。[6]近年来我国各大高校采用VisualC++6.0编程,在Windows操作系统下实现了人机界面和直观的数据显示。该平台将组合导航的理论方案与导航设备相结合,可以进行室内试验系统的调试和研究,还可以提供直观的界面显示、数据图表等。[9]课题主要内容系统的程序开发包括对微惯性传感器/组件的实时采集、曲线绘制、显示和存储。组合导航平台可以实现MEMSIMU和GPS等姿态、位置、速度等解算结果的数据显示,曲线显示,数据存储等功能。课题研究方案1.捷联惯导系统的工作原理;2.推导捷联惯导系统姿态、位置、速度更新计算,采用Matlab/Vb编程测试;3.构建INS/GPS导航系统界面;4.完成对组合导航系统的实时采集、曲线的绘制、显示和存储程序编制;5.针对不同导航任务要求,编制系统测试界面与后台运行程序。五.日程安排1.2013第1周查阅相关资料,完成开题报告;2.2013第2-5周熟悉捷联惯导系统的原理,熟悉VisualBasic语言;捷联惯导系统姿态、位置、速度更新公式推导,完成Matlab/Vb程序测试;3.2013第6-9周构建INS/GPS导航系统界面,完成对导航系统解算结果的实时采集、曲线的绘制、显示和存储程序编制;4.2013第10-12周测试系统编制程序;5.2012第13-16周翻译资料,写论文,准备答辩进度安排。参考文献[1]惯性器件与惯性导航系统邓志红付梦印张继伟主编科学出版社[2]卫星导航系统概论边少锋李文魁主编电子工业出版社[3]DaiidELewis.Ulira-tightlycoupledom/INStrackingperformance.AIAA.s3rdAnnua.lDenver,CoLorado,2003[4]BeserJ,Alex,Caner.Alow-costguidance/navigationunitintegratingASAASM-BasedGPSandMEMSIMUinADeeplyCoupledMe.IONGPS2002,Portland,Oregon,2002[5]安东,郑锷,任思聪.一种新型深组合GPS/INS系统的设计与性能仿真研究.中国惯性技术学报,1995[6]AlionsK,Brown.TestresultofaGPS/INSusingalowcostMEMSIMU.Proceedingsof11thAnnualSaintPetersburgIntern